Consider a function f(x, y, z) given by

f(x, y, z) = (x² + y² – 2z²)(y² + z²)

The partial derivative of this function with respect to x at the point x = 2, y = 1 and z = 3 is _______

Correct Answer

40-40

Solution & Step-by-step Explanation

Concept:

In Partial Differentiation, all variables are considered as a constant except the independent derivative variable i.e If f(x,y,z) is a function, then its partial derivative with respect to x is calculated by keeping y and z as constant.

Calculation:

f(x, y, z) = (x² + y² – 2z²)(y² + z²)



At the point, x = 2, y = 1 and z = 3 is
